Quarterbacks

Jimmy Garoppolo, San Francisco 49ers

Everyone has Jimmy G fever, and it makes sense after he’s thrown for an average of 336 yards in his first three games. But he’s a fade this week against the Jaguars, who have given up just 190.5 passing yards per game so far this year.

Marcus Mariota, Tennessee Titans

Mariota draws the Rams, who have allowed the seventh-fewest fantasy points to opposing quarterbacks this year, including multiple scores in just four contests (and only two since Week 4). Mariota has thrown for fewer than 200 yards in three of his past four games and he has only three multi-score games this year.
